How to Compare Unsecured Personal Financing and Borrow Responsibly in 2026

Personal financing can help consumers address debt consolidation, emergency expenses, vehicle repairs, home improvements, medical costs, moving expenses, and other significant financial needs. Online applications have also made it easier to research providers without visiting multiple physical branches.

Convenience should not replace careful comparison. Consumers should evaluate annual percentage rate (APR), interest charges, origination fees, repayment length, monthly payment, net proceeds, and total repayment before accepting an offer. They should also determine whether the company collecting their information is the actual lender or an affiliate, marketplace, publisher, or lender-connection service.

The lowest advertised rate is not necessarily the rate an individual applicant will receive. Credit profile, income, existing obligations, requested amount, repayment period, and provider-specific underwriting can affect eligibility and pricing.

3. Compare APR, Interest Rates, and Fees

Consumers evaluating Personal Loans Cheap Interest should understand the difference between an interest rate and APR. A seemingly attractive interest percentage does not necessarily represent the complete cost.

The Terms and Conditions and required disclosures should identify relevant charges and repayment requirements. Consumers should examine these documents rather than relying exclusively on advertisements.

With Personal Loans Unsecured, origination charges can be particularly important to understand. If a provider deducts a fee from proceeds, the borrower may receive less cash than the stated principal.

Consumers researching Personal Loans Banks should ask for comparable information from each institution: principal, APR, fees, repayment period, payment amount, and total repayment.

4. Calculate Payments Before Applying

People researching Personal Loans Unsecured can benefit from estimating payments before completing applications. Calculations establish an affordability benchmark before actual offers arrive.

Someone seeking Personal Loans Cheap Interest can model several hypothetical rates to see how borrowing costs affect the monthly obligation.

When comparing Personal Loans Banks, keep the principal and repayment period consistent where possible. Otherwise, a lower payment might simply reflect a substantially longer repayment schedule.

Consumers using Personal Loans Near Me resources can take potential local offers and compare them against online alternatives using exactly the same calculation.

Finally, review the Terms and Conditions of an actual offer because a calculator cannot account for every fee, contractual provision, or lender-specific requirement.

Consider a hypothetical $10,000 balance repaid over 36 months:

Illustrative RateApprox. Monthly PaymentApprox. Total Paid
8%$313$11,281
14%$342$12,305
20%$372$13,379
26%$403$14,502
32%$435$15,666

Illustrative Payment Graph

 
Hypothetical $10,000 Balance — 36 Months

 8%  | ███████████████████████████████          $313
14%  | ██████████████████████████████████       $342
20%  | █████████████████████████████████████    $372
26%  | ████████████████████████████████████████ $403
32%  | ███████████████████████████████████████████ $435
 

This is an educational illustration only. These figures are not market averages, lender quotes, guaranteed rates, or predictions of terms available to a particular borrower.

7. Consider Debt Consolidation Carefully

Consumers considering Personal Loans Unsecured for debt consolidation should first list the balances, interest rates, payments, and anticipated payoff periods of the debts they intend to replace.

People seeking Personal Loans Cheap Interest for consolidation should calculate whether the proposed financing actually reduces their borrowing costs after fees are considered.

Consumers comparing Personal Loans Banks can request offers based on approximately the same principal and term, making it easier to evaluate competing proposals.

Someone using Personal Loans Near Me resources may also want to speak with local financial institutions about potential consolidation products while comparing them with legitimate online alternatives.

The Terms and Conditions of the proposed financing should be examined for origination charges, repayment requirements, late-payment provisions, and other important details.

Suppose a consumer consolidates several credit-card balances into one installment obligation. Having one payment instead of several may simplify budgeting, but simplification does not necessarily produce savings.

A longer repayment period can reduce the monthly payment while increasing how long interest accumulates. Borrowers should therefore compare total repayment—not merely the size of the first monthly bill.

8. Protect Yourself When Searching for Financing

Consumers using Personal Loans Near Me resources should verify unfamiliar businesses before providing Social Security numbers, bank information, identification documents, or other sensitive data.

People researching Personal Loans Banks should use official financial-institution websites rather than blindly following links in unsolicited messages.

Consumers interested in Personal Loans Unsecured should be skeptical of websites claiming that everyone qualifies regardless of financial circumstances.

Advertisements for Personal Loans Cheap Interest should also be treated carefully when the advertised rate appears unusually favorable but qualification requirements and fees are difficult to locate.

Always read the Terms and Conditions and related disclosures before accepting an obligation or providing payment information.

The Federal Trade Commission’s credit and loan resources provide additional information about borrowing and potentially deceptive financial practices.

Consumers should be particularly cautious if an unknown company demands gift cards, cryptocurrency, wire transfers, or unusual advance payments to supposedly guarantee financing.

Final Thoughts

Personal borrowing can provide useful financial flexibility, but consumers should evaluate the complete transaction rather than concentrating on a single advertised feature.

Begin by determining the amount genuinely required. Borrowing more than necessary can increase both the monthly obligation and total interest expense. Establishing an affordable payment before requesting financing can also prevent a lender’s maximum approval from determining how much you borrow.

Next, compare multiple legitimate providers when practical. Banks, credit unions, online financial companies, and connection services can play different roles and may present different eligibility requirements.

Pay particular attention to APR and fees. A low advertised interest percentage does not necessarily identify the least expensive offer, especially when origination charges or substantially different repayment periods are involved.

The hypothetical calculation above demonstrates why rate differences matter. On the same principal and repayment period, increasing the assumed rate raises both the monthly payment and total repayment.

Consumers should also identify whether the website receiving their information actually provides the financing. Affiliate and connection services can help consumers reach participating providers, but the ultimate creditor determines approval, amount, pricing, and repayment requirements.

Finally, avoid guaranteed-approval claims and advance-fee demands. Verify unfamiliar businesses, protect sensitive information, and rely on the actual financing disclosures when making a decision.
